Due to conflicts with land reforms, it was repealed by the 44th Amendment in 1978 and replaced with Article 300A, making it a legal right. Key aspects of the transformation of Article 31: Original Status: Part of Fundamental Rights (Part III). Article 31(1): Stated that no person shall be deprived of his property save by authority of law. Article 31(2): Required the state to provide compensation if acquiring private property for public purposes. Repeal: The 44th Constitutional Amendment Act, 1978, abolished the right to property as a fundamental right. Current Status (Article 300A): Property is now a legal/constitutional right, meaning it cannot be taken except through lawful authority, but it cannot be directly enforced by the Supreme Court under Article 32.Updates
